dog blankets ( Native American blankets) (animal blankets, <blankets by location or context>, ... Furnishings and Equipment (hierarchy name))

 

Note: Blankets comprising a cloth or velvet covering with cloth ties on the underside made to cover the front and sides of a dog's body. Usually richly decorated in floral beadwork and cloth fringe, with bells placed along the center cut of the blanket. Used to protect sled dogs and to herald the sled's arrival. Originated with the Métis and later spread to Athabaskan communities.
